Text:

Job-hunting has been a very discouraging process. However, today's mail brought an Illinois State scholarship. I'll have to do some investigating, and see what I can work out with the family, budget, and my own time. Of course, I very much want to go back and complete my degree although this is not a very convenient time in terms of the families' needs. I'll keep you up to date as plans are firmed up.
